dd13e01ac6
Extra check on existance of template, to be more forgiving if some template in the productionqueue doesn't exist.
...
This was SVN commit r15103.
2014-05-03 17:29:22 +00:00
e70eccf0ca
Added Stan's contributor ptol_corral details in Lordgood's model
...
Added Stan's Cleopatra texture
This was SVN commit r15102.
2014-05-03 13:05:34 +00:00
575cdd7979
A spearman isn't ranged
...
This was SVN commit r15101.
2014-05-03 13:04:08 +00:00
b09925b27e
switch the game setup confirmation buttons and move the welcome screen buttons
...
This was SVN commit r15100.
2014-05-03 09:21:05 +00:00
542bc1b273
Further fix switched buttons
...
This was SVN commit r15099.
2014-05-03 09:07:31 +00:00
c1d5f6882c
Also switch the button name to disable the correct one.
...
4e0a588456
only switched the label and the action.
This was SVN commit r15098.
2014-05-03 08:59:31 +00:00
12ec51783d
Fix in-game manual display
...
This was SVN commit r15097.
2014-05-03 08:53:06 +00:00
4e0a588456
Switch more buttons, see 911be4e860
...
This was SVN commit r15096.
2014-05-03 08:45:19 +00:00
f066549523
Makes the other players default to unassigned instead of Default AI in a sandbox map.
...
This was SVN commit r15095.
2014-05-03 04:00:14 +00:00
122dae799b
Don't allow returning an invalid locale from the advanced language menu.
...
This was SVN commit r15094.
2014-05-02 21:14:28 +00:00
99486ed7ab
Add camera to the second player, somehow avoids strange errors.
...
This was SVN commit r15093.
2014-05-02 20:08:48 +00:00
b8e9bae75e
fixes Petra trying to keep going with a canceled attack
...
This was SVN commit r15092.
2014-05-02 11:03:24 +00:00
15f56cd984
Fix armour and attack display of heroes
...
This was SVN commit r15091.
2014-05-02 10:32:21 +00:00
ace3269768
Fix problem with sprintf errors being thrown when the AI places structures on the wrong places, make the code more uniform. Fixes #2485
...
This was SVN commit r15090.
2014-05-02 10:09:53 +00:00
a36a0bbd87
Improve my previous fix by throwing error objects instead of strings
...
This was SVN commit r15089.
2014-05-02 07:34:05 +00:00
aaf92409c9
Fix sprintf error reporting by printing the stack trace, and not trying to translate the calls
...
This was SVN commit r15088.
2014-05-02 07:27:44 +00:00
5658bb391b
fix delete selection no more working after #15074
...
This was SVN commit r15087.
2014-05-01 21:06:43 +00:00
210374d86d
Fixes Aegis not training additional units when no starting units are around.
...
Patch by Teiresias.
Fixes #2460
This was SVN commit r15086.
2014-05-01 13:13:38 +00:00
b9af0ac0e4
Enlarge various elements of the lobby login page to fit other languages.
...
This was SVN commit r15085.
2014-05-01 12:59:50 +00:00
a64456e6d8
Fix small space issue in the lobby (still some work to do there)
...
This was SVN commit r15084.
2014-05-01 11:38:53 +00:00
47fc05d696
String freeze? Who said that?
...
Fix typo: avalible → available.
This was SVN commit r15082.
2014-05-01 01:22:59 +00:00
d51f2a0c35
Version bump and regeneration of translation templates accordingly.
...
This was SVN commit r15081.
2014-05-01 00:44:47 +00:00
c7b0261860
Fix the numbering in the Terms of Use for the lobby. Reverts 813db55b08
.
...
This was SVN commit r15079.
2014-04-30 23:24:24 +00:00
62f5476dec
Add support for adding translation context to XML elements. Patch by Gallaecio.
...
Add translation context to some lobby headers.
This was SVN commit r15078.
2014-04-30 22:33:08 +00:00
11865a8865
Revert a hack that snuck into an earlier commit of mine.
...
This was SVN commit r15076.
2014-04-30 17:22:38 +00:00
911be4e860
The convention is confirm button on right, decline button on left (updates some in-game dialogs). Also enables GLSL.
...
This was SVN commit r15074.
2014-04-30 06:28:57 +00:00
90581f366c
This was SVN commit r15073.
2014-04-30 05:36:50 +00:00
e7b4c8b92a
Make game automatically resume after closing the options menu. Refs #2507
...
This was SVN commit r15072.
2014-04-30 05:31:44 +00:00
a88f1222c0
Update AI descriptions, closes #2500 . Also correct some capitalization and developer overlay transparency for #2507 .
...
This was SVN commit r15071.
2014-04-30 05:04:12 +00:00
748ebdfdb0
Various GUI fixes and cleanup.
...
This was SVN commit r15070.
2014-04-30 04:38:53 +00:00
dfacf5358c
New lobby connect/registration page. Not perfect but fixes most of the outstanding issues. Refs #2312
...
This was SVN commit r15069.
2014-04-30 00:46:57 +00:00
15e9ffa21b
Converts the save dialog to the modern UI. Refs #2507 .
...
This was SVN commit r15068.
2014-04-29 21:45:00 +00:00
29cab5f5ed
Also change reveal map to revealed map.
...
Fix typo in tutorial map. Remove message refering to finite fields.
This was SVN commit r15066.
2014-04-29 14:51:21 +00:00
b246017f9f
Explore_d_ map.
...
This was SVN commit r15065.
2014-04-29 13:10:56 +00:00
b3ab49bb30
Really remove the minimum damage of 1, what 37c8e77d8e
was supposed to do
...
This was SVN commit r15064.
2014-04-29 07:15:10 +00:00
1e6614918b
Initial modern buttons. Lobby/prelobby now only rely on the modern common files.
...
This was SVN commit r15063.
2014-04-29 00:07:27 +00:00
c77826e9aa
Translate some message boxes when opening websites.
...
Fix a typo. Refs #2501 .
This was SVN commit r15062.
2014-04-28 22:30:40 +00:00
683170ea19
Enable/disable GenTangents when enabling/disabling PreferGLSL. Fixes #2505 .
...
This was SVN commit r15061.
2014-04-28 22:30:27 +00:00
876d0e4e66
Forgot to fix some strings
...
This was SVN commit r15060.
2014-04-28 20:19:32 +00:00
e6e5b9f11f
Add a link in the main menu to for translators. Patch by Stan, fixes #2501
...
This was SVN commit r15059.
2014-04-28 20:17:39 +00:00
64d3d0b4b2
Remove falsely attributed quote.
...
This was SVN commit r15058.
2014-04-28 17:59:02 +00:00
4695f3425b
Add the possibility to show the welcome screen on every update, next to the possibility to disable it completely. Patch by Itms, fixes #2116
...
This was SVN commit r15057.
2014-04-28 17:18:46 +00:00
f26a2917d3
Translate map name in the summary page
...
This was SVN commit r15056.
2014-04-28 15:54:47 +00:00
b8245da606
Improve disabled technology tooltip. Fixes #2497
...
This was SVN commit r15055.
2014-04-28 15:17:26 +00:00
a49b359748
Fix formations attacking by adding a combat.approaching state. Fixes #2496
...
This was SVN commit r15054.
2014-04-28 13:05:47 +00:00
b5dfacbf18
Translated map name in the loading screen, regenerated translation templates and updated translations from Transifex
...
This was SVN commit r15053.
2014-04-28 12:31:28 +00:00
fb80e29d41
Changes to English tooltips for consistency
...
Reported by an Italian translator, Fabio, at Transifex:
https://www.transifex.com/projects/p/0ad/translate/#it/public/13718374
https://www.transifex.com/projects/p/0ad/translate/#it/public/24494405
The periods were added in the main menu (only 2 tooltips without them)
and removed from the options menu (only 1 tooltip with it). In the
future, we might want to be consistent with tooltips through all the
GUI.
This was SVN commit r15052.
2014-04-28 10:11:11 +00:00
75713cc101
Don't display 'UNR' in the gamesetup on unranked players. This makes unranked lobby playernames consistant with those of rankless players who join via IP.
...
This was SVN commit r15051.
2014-04-28 05:39:18 +00:00
da7526dbd4
Tweaked button.
...
This was SVN commit r15049.
2014-04-27 23:48:15 +00:00
a8b50a66da
Fixes to the lobby internationalization by sanderd17 and me
...
All strings are now translated at the last point, right before they are
added to the GUI.
Some other fixes are included.
This was SVN commit r15046.
2014-04-27 20:24:48 +00:00
b3acb5657f
Fix moderater prefixes in the lobby.
...
This was SVN commit r15045.
2014-04-27 19:26:12 +00:00
251372a062
Missing var statement.
...
This was SVN commit r15044.
2014-04-27 19:10:28 +00:00
cfb72e990b
Make gamesetup chat formatting more similar to the lobby and note that all players must be ready before starting a multiplayer game.
...
This was SVN commit r15043.
2014-04-27 19:06:21 +00:00
8f53ddd6b9
Unifies some translatable strings on the gamesetup screen.
...
This was SVN commit r15042.
2014-04-27 19:03:15 +00:00
2f8487b84b
Adds translation support for the "More options" window on the gamesetup screen.
...
This was SVN commit r15041.
2014-04-27 18:41:56 +00:00
983abd1952
Updates splashscreen style and adds a background to the scrollbar to match the dropdown
...
This was SVN commit r15040.
2014-04-27 18:30:40 +00:00
a163ac1c11
Reverts a rogue copy-paste in the last commit.
...
This was SVN commit r15039.
2014-04-27 18:23:15 +00:00
b8d3ef71f7
Fixes the updated dropdowns for multiplayer clients broken in 65f4c8b0e8
...
This was SVN commit r15038.
2014-04-27 18:18:05 +00:00
461a17c95d
Reverted d91756b251
after breaking the fix for the lobby that sanders17 had implemented
...
This was SVN commit r15037.
2014-04-27 17:38:19 +00:00
65f4c8b0e8
Moves Select number of players to a more fitting and translation-friendly location. Also makes the map selection texts more translation-friendly in terms of space.
...
This was SVN commit r15036.
2014-04-27 17:24:37 +00:00
f9ccf05aa8
Change the style of dropdowns as per Mythos_Ruler. Also moves the rating list to the right side of the leaderboard (where it is on most rating lists).
...
This was SVN commit r15035.
2014-04-27 16:28:59 +00:00
60334f05c8
Fix error introduced in 95b0a8d9bf
while fixing a warning
...
This was SVN commit r15034.
2014-04-27 15:56:10 +00:00
63bcf2fef6
Don't display I'm ready in single player setup. Refs #2447 .
...
This was SVN commit r15033.
2014-04-27 15:32:22 +00:00
ce0f439817
Adjusts the lobby gamelist and dropdowns to support more translations (space-wise).
...
This was SVN commit r15032.
2014-04-27 14:52:32 +00:00
95b0a8d9bf
Fixed warnings in ‘gui’ due to the new SpiderMonkey
...
Refs #2372
This was SVN commit r15030.
2014-04-27 13:51:43 +00:00
60e1ff59f5
Fix warning about msg.guid not being defined
...
This was SVN commit r15029.
2014-04-27 13:38:17 +00:00
341bcb1cf9
Fix unfinished change in accidental commit d4109916a3
...
This was SVN commit r15028.
2014-04-27 13:37:26 +00:00
d4109916a3
Moved the translation of AI messages to a later point
...
This avoids attempts to translate messages prefixed with keywords,
such as “/team Message prefixed with a keyword”, and translates them
only after the keyword has been removed. Some keywords may hide the
message, removing the need for a translation altogether.
This was SVN commit r15027.
2014-04-27 13:33:15 +00:00
d91756b251
Moved the translation of map data to the loadMap() function
...
This avoids the translation of strings that had been previously
translated later in the code.
This was SVN commit r15026.
2014-04-27 13:28:47 +00:00
e344225b72
Tweaked this description.
...
This was SVN commit r15025.
2014-04-27 13:11:50 +00:00
ad5fb85de3
A bunch of tech tweaks.
...
Tweaked Belgian Bog environment.
This was SVN commit r15024.
2014-04-27 13:10:38 +00:00
813db55b08
Fixed the numbering in the terms of user of the lobby
...
Reported by ‘tema’ (Italian translator) at Transifex:
https://www.transifex.com/projects/p/0ad/translate/#it/public/24566468
This was SVN commit r15022.
2014-04-27 10:02:23 +00:00
243411f0c5
Internationalization of the lobby terms of service and terms of use
...
This was SVN commit r15021.
2014-04-27 09:13:28 +00:00
0db4cc690e
Check for hero attack before querying it. Fixes #2490
...
This was SVN commit r15020.
2014-04-27 08:03:15 +00:00
81883806ec
First version of the lobby Terms of Service and Terms of Use.
...
This was SVN commit r15019.
2014-04-27 05:59:48 +00:00
2ad7187f92
Move XMPP polling to the mainloop. Should reduce lobby disconnects. Fixes #2491
...
This was SVN commit r15018.
2014-04-27 05:37:34 +00:00
fe490df93a
Revert an unnecessary part of the last commit ( bc9b7f9af3
).
...
This was SVN commit r15017.
2014-04-27 03:26:45 +00:00
bc9b7f9af3
Fixes the tutorial AI and updates the tutorial with the blacksmith.
...
This was SVN commit r15016.
2014-04-27 03:22:02 +00:00
98905af6eb
Added a context to some very generic strings and regenerated the public mod POT file
...
This was SVN commit r15015.
2014-04-27 00:23:19 +00:00
0d3c608b05
Increases title bar width for internationalization support and unsquishes map preview in the lobby
...
This was SVN commit r15014.
2014-04-27 00:07:27 +00:00
f9dec493fc
Changed Ptolemaic and Seleucid Military Colonies to use the merc camp actor for now until proper Military Colony meshes are modeled.
...
Shrank the size of the gear icon.
Added a "seeds" particle. Doesn't seem to be working though.
This was SVN commit r15013.
2014-04-26 22:49:33 +00:00
aaf5ad1a63
Cosmetic cleanup - Delete full stop and make scrollbar a circle
...
This was SVN commit r15012.
2014-04-26 22:45:48 +00:00
9a809c3131
Revert overlay resizing (forgot about translations) and minor fixes to my last changes.
...
This was SVN commit r15010.
2014-04-26 19:52:56 +00:00
2ae1e16628
Fix translation of some game setup elements in multiplayer games
...
This was SVN commit r15009.
2014-04-26 19:52:16 +00:00
abf12fb503
Enhance the main menu options page and use it to replace the in-game settings page..
...
This was SVN commit r15007.
2014-04-26 19:31:23 +00:00
d1d7afe46c
Implements ready status into gamesetup. Fixes #2447 .
...
This was SVN commit r15006.
2014-04-26 18:34:34 +00:00
4770e64449
Some i18n fixed on the JavaScript side
...
Do not try to translate empty strings in translateObjectKeys().
Do not try to translate empty formation tooltips.
Do not translate player names at a point where they are already
translated.
This was SVN commit r15005.
2014-04-26 18:27:53 +00:00
f5b0fc1076
Swap button placement on options page to be more consistant with other parts of the GUI.
...
This was SVN commit r15004.
2014-04-26 18:03:29 +00:00
3dd76c84bc
Added a translation comment to the ‘Locale:’ string of the language menu
...
In order to do this, I added support for extracting the ‘comment’
attribute of translatable XML elements.
This was SVN commit r15000.
2014-04-26 12:51:12 +00:00
49fc88ff81
Fixed typos on the English strings of the tutorial AI
...
This was SVN commit r14994.
2014-04-25 19:47:41 +00:00
4cbaba418b
Improved syntagma animations
...
Added seeding animation for farms. Only applied in Macedonian women at
the moment.
This was SVN commit r14993.
2014-04-25 14:29:05 +00:00
e92bf0c89d
Show translated player name in chat messages
...
This should only affect player names that users do not define, such as
“Player 2”.
I’ve checked that:
• This change translate the name of the AI player in chat messages of
tutorial scenarios.
• If I name myself “Player 1” and host a multiplayer game, “Player 1” is
not translated.
This was SVN commit r14992.
2014-04-25 04:28:06 +00:00
7afe0afbca
Internationalized the messages of the tutorial AI
...
This was SVN commit r14991.
2014-04-25 03:41:01 +00:00
abed1b1734
Made the developer overlay wide enough for the Long Strings locale
...
This was SVN commit r14990.
2014-04-25 03:11:22 +00:00
c1c10667df
Improved the internationalization of the construction “Insufficient resources” message
...
This was SVN commit r14988.
2014-04-25 02:45:19 +00:00
0c88edc2f2
Internationalized rank names
...
In order to do so, I had to extend the XML message extractor to support
using XML tags as context.
This is because one of the ranks is “Advanced”, which is a pretty common
string.
This was SVN commit r14986.
2014-04-25 01:47:42 +00:00
0027dcef31
Remove the actual serif fonts from the repo (they're completely unused now, and keeping them makes the package bigger)
...
This was SVN commit r14981.
2014-04-24 13:36:29 +00:00
73470a3610
Remove all references to serif fonts in the GUI files (see cde72788a2
)
...
Rebuild the sans fonts to include the missing glyph character (fixes
#2483 )
Update the pot files
This was SVN commit r14980.
2014-04-24 13:33:15 +00:00
bfa6bbd0e0
Internationalized the wall cost string
...
Also, added a check for the getCostComponentDisplayName() function, as I
once got an empty string, although I was not able to reproduce it.
This was SVN commit r14979.
2014-04-24 06:16:43 +00:00
1fa5f13133
Improved the internationalization of the Diplomacy dialog box
...
You can now translate resource names differently depending on whether
they are in the middle of a sentence or at the beginning.
The Close button in the Diplomacy dialog box is now internationalized.
This was SVN commit r14978.
2014-04-24 05:48:23 +00:00